MOHE and LMM Set to Hold Dialogue in May, Announces Deputy Minister

Bukit baru: A dialogue session between the Higher Education Ministry (MOHE) and Liga Mahasiswa Malaysia (LMM) is anticipated to occur by May at the latest, according to its deputy minister, Adam Adli Abdul Halim.

According to BERNAMA News Agency, the organization of the dialogue is in its final stages, with preparations underway for a roundtable discussion and periodic open sessions aimed at addressing issues concerning tertiary students. Adam Adli expressed apologies for the delay in organizing the event and assured that by May, a meaningful dialogue session would be conducted, moving beyond a simple 'touch and go' format.

Adam Adli highlighted that the dialogue session would not merely involve receiving and reading memoranda without further action. Instead, it will feature comprehensive discussions among various parties, including university administrators, academics, and students. The deputy minister emphasized the need for all voices to be genuinely heard and for discussions to be accompanied by substantive actions, ensuring that every issue raised receives proper attention, even those critical or opposing the ministry's stand.

He further underscored the importance of agreeing to disagree, advocating for the rights and voices of students to be respected and for their role in the policy-making process to be expanded. Adam Adli noted that this initiative had been planned since his first day in the MADANI Cabinet, aiming to create a platform that empowers tertiary students to act as a force of checks and balances.
